Job description of a Home Care Nurse

Home Care Nurses provide care to patients in their homes under the guidance of a doctor. They perform regular visits where they monitor the patient’s condition, assess their wounds, and change dressings as required. Home Care Nurses also write reports and communicate with the doctor after each visit.

Home Care Nurse Duties and Responsibilities

Home Care Nurse job description should contain a variety of functions and roles including:

  • Traveling to patients’ homes and managing their care plans according to physicians’ instructions.
  • Administering medication and insulin, and completing blood pressure, glucose, urine, and stool tests.
  • Inspecting wounds, changing dressings, and handling personal grooming and hygiene.
  • Testing for muscle weakness, bedsores, and any signs of infection.
  • Listening to the concerns of family members and answering their questions.
  • Educating caregivers and family on the aftercare or ongoing care of the patient.
  • Providing suggestions for improved healthcare to physicians and family members of the patient.
  • Monitoring patient recovery and compiling reports for the physician.
  • Keeping abreast of developments in healthcare and attending workshops and lectures as required.
  • Collaborating with doctors and other healthcare professionals to develop improved diets and healthcare plans for patients.

Home Care Nurse Requirements / Skills / Qualifications

Home Care Nurse job description should include these common skills and q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Nursing or similar.
  • Additional courses in Biology, Anatomy, and Science may be required.
  • Relevant license and certification.
  • Excellent report writing skills.
  • Active listening skills and empathy.
  • Physical and mental strength.
  • A valid driver’s license and reliable transport may be required.
  • A completed apprenticeship or experience in a similar role.
  • Excellent observational and problem-solving skills.
  • The ability to follow instructions but also to act independently if necessary.
